If you've ever wanted to teach engineering students how to develop and conduct their own experiments while optimizing a balloon propelled cart through 3d printing, but didn't know where to start, you're in luck! This 3D printable kit is designed to help students learn the engineering design process by providing pre-made 3D printed carts for testing. The idea behind this project came from a class activity where students made balloon carts out of recycled materials. The goal was to introduce students to testing various aspects of the cart, such as wheel type and diameter, but the actual building and collecting of materials took too long and became the main focus. This 3D printed kit solves that problem by providing pre-made carts for students to test. Later, students can apply what they learn from the initial testing to design their own better 3D-printed carts.
